What happens

Gata Salvaje (English: Wild Cat) is a telenovela which aired first on Venevisión in Venezuela on May 16, 2002. It was released some days later on the Spanish language US TV network Univision from mid-summer 2002 until May 2003. Later, it aired in Mexico on Canal de las Estrellas from January 2003 to December 2003. This is one of two telenovelas starring Marlene Favela and Mario Cimarro as the main protagonists, the other being Los Herederos Del Monte from Telemundo. Venezuelan actresses Carolina Tejera and Marjorie de Sousa, Mexican actor Ariel López Padilla, Colombian actress Aura Cristina Geithner, and Puerto Rican actress Mara Croatto also make up part of the cast.
